How accurate are the prices shown?+

Choose My Lawyer uses the best information available at the time of your search.

Some prices are verified directly by firms and others are estimated using structured pricing methodologies where directly comparable information is unavailable.

Prices include standard legal fees, VAT where applicable, HM Land Registry fees and a standard search pack.

Legitimate price changes can sometimes occur if your transaction changes or additional information becomes available.

Why might prices change later?+

Some costs can only become known once a firm has reviewed your transaction in more detail.

Examples may include additional searches, leasehold costs or other transaction-specific expenses.

Where prices change, we believe firms should explain clearly what has changed and why.

What happens after I select a firm?+

After you choose Select or Request a callback, we ask only for the information needed so firms can contact you.

We will show you a summary of the information being shared and ask for your consent before anything is sent.

Firms will first complete conflict checks before confirming whether they can act and should then explain the next steps to you.

We will send you a copy of the information shared and may follow up afterwards to check what happened and improve the quality of information shown to future users.
